My friend and I recently did the Flanders Fields tour with Quasimodo Tours out of Bruges and it was one of the main highlights of our 5 week trip around Europe. Philippe, along with his Australian wife Sharon, made the day flow effortlessly. We were picked up from our hotel by Sharon and taken on a short drive to meet Philippe in the Mini-bus. It's only a small tour of about a dozen people so we get plenty of personal attention and time to chat to Philippe who is so knowledgeable and passionate about WW1 history. He reaally gave us all such an insight into the tragedies and triumphs of the battles in that particular area during the First War. It was a really emotional day but I'm so glad I did it. Wouldnt recommend it for children but anyone with the remotest interest in WW1 history will come away with an understanding and in-depth knowledge you can't glean from any books. Highly recommended. And the scenery is gorgeous - an added bonus. Would love lto see more of Belgium now.
